Note however, many if not most agencies will not respond to email questions, that's why the inbox is always full. Best approaches are to call and ask for info and snail mail a short, less than one page letter about yourself with you stats, contct infom etc and 2 or 3 good photos, including a full face shot and a ful length shot (you will probably not get them back!). Some agencies no longer longer offer open calls and will reply to a letter only if interested in you.

AnToNiA BaKaLoVa wrote:
I'm planning on going as soon as I get more shots.

Why?

We've had this conversation before.  Elite doesn't want you to get "more shots".  They just want to see you.  More shots won't help.  At most they are a security blanket, and the wrong shots could hurt you, not help.  You ought to stop wasting time and effort and go to the open calls now.

If Elite likes you they will tell you to get  more shots.  But they will tell you the kind they want, and who can shoot it.

You don't need shots for an open call. You just have to look good, marketable and like a girl that can be transformed into a model. They either like what they see or they don't.

Open calls are not interviews. Imagine this. A room with 40 girls in it. Someone walks in, points and says, you and you, the rest of you can leave. Or, they say, everyone can leave now.

Pictures needed will come after you get representation.

Fred Brown wrote:
You don't need shots for an open call.

Actually for Elite, you do. Snap shots for new models and a snap shot plus book or comp card for experienced models. If you don't have ts, Vicky will tell you to come back next week with them.


Neither Click nor Arline Wilson have opencalls. You can stop by Arline Wilson anytime...but it's best to mail in unless you have a currently needed look. Click will only let you submit through mail.
